Output 8609fbac2da3cec86c1e2264e38a625d6e7e6fe9cbbaaf37470a3911cf323f56:0

value
3620657
script pubkey
OP_0 OP_PUSHBYTES_20 dd6c69fa8d5c78da1d4de006635bcc5c0a406fb3
address
bc1qm4kxn75dt3ud582duqrxxk7vts9yqmanh9gkap
transaction
8609fbac2da3cec86c1e2264e38a625d6e7e6fe9cbbaaf37470a3911cf323f56
spent
true